    Disco Ball Python Stuff

    Had a chance to see some of Ted Thompson's Disco Ball Stuff. He originally thought it was a fire but it turned out to be something totally different. It really cleans up other morphs and who know what it will do with other combos. Here is a link with the story behind the disco

    http://s-ecto.com/collection/view_de...sp?id=20051123

    I hope you guys like the pics.
